Is faking Christmas spicy?

Faking Christmas by Cindy Steel is generally considered a low-spice, "closed-door" romance, focusing more on witty banter, emotional depth, and romantic tension rather than explicit content. While it features steamy kisses, "feral tension," and a "sizzle" factor, it is described as a sweet, cozy holiday read.

Is 1/3,5/7,9/10,8,6/4,2 a first edition book?

For a period of several years, they indicated a first printing with a number line that began with β€œ2”. Anness Publishing uses a number line that reads 1 3 5 7 9 10 8 6 4 2. The 1 indicates that this is a first printing. This same number line in a third print run would look like this: 3 5 7 9 10 8 6 4.

How hot is too hot for books?

Tips for Storing Books

Temperature and Relative Humidity (rH): A cool (70 degrees Fahrenheit or below) and relatively dry (30-55% relative humidity) environment is safe for most books.

What is the 5 finger rule for books?

The five-finger rule for reading is a simple test to see if a book is the right difficulty level for a reader, especially children, by counting unknown words on a sample page. You open a book, read a random page, and hold up a finger for each word you don't know or can't pronounce; 0-1 fingers means too easy, 2-3 is just right for a challenge, 4-5 (or more) means it's too hard and you should pick another book. This helps find books that are engaging but not frustrating.

What is the #1 most read book?

The #1 most-read book in the world is generally considered to be The Bible, followed closely by The Quran, due to their immense global distribution and reverence as religious texts, with estimates placing The Bible's sales/distribution in the billions. For non-religious works, Don Quixote and Quotations from Chairman Mao Tse-tung (the "Little Red Book") are often cited as the best-selling single books, while the Harry Potter series leads among modern series.
